Retraction to: K284-6111 prevents the amyloid beta-induced neuroinflammation and impairment of recognition memory through inhibition of NF-κB-mediated CHI3L1 expression (Journal of Neuroinflammation, (2018), 15, 1, (224), 10.1186/s12974-018-1269-3)

Abstract

The Editors-in-Chief has retracted this article. After publication concerns were raised about apparent duplications of blots with different protein labels between Figs. 4 and 6, 5 and 6, and within Fig. 6. None of the authors have responded to correspondence about this issue or the publisher’s request for original images and raw data. The Editor-in-Chief no longer has confidence in the results and conclusions of the article. The Authors did not respond to correspondence from the Publisher about this retraction.
